Shutting down power to radar dishes is part of the Week 14 legendary quests in Fortnite Chapter 2 Season 7, which, if you want the XP, must be completed before the end of the season.

This legendary quest set begins with collecting instructions from Slone from a payphone, warning three characters - any character - of impending doom and placing warning signs.

Completing this challenge will reward you with 30k XP, which will help you unlock more Battle Stars for the Season 7 Battle Pass. You'll also be able to complete the next legendary quest - spoil the Mole's sabotage attempt.

Radar dishes locations in Fortnite explained

You need to shut down two of the seven radar dishes located on the Fortnite map and each radar dish can be found within the IO bases.

Radar dish locations in Fortnite.

Once you've decided which bases you wish to visit for this legendary quest, you need to head to the base of the radar dish. There you'll find a small power box, which, once interacted with, will shut down the power for that radar dish.

Interact with the power boxes at the bottom of the radar dishes.

Remember - you need to shut down the power for two radar dishes to complete this challenge, which means you need to visit two IO bases. For this reason, if you want to complete this quest in one match, it's a good idea to visit the Weeping Woods and Slurpy Swamp bases, since they're close to each other.
